How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Inglewood?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Inglewood Studio Apartments | $1,992 | $812 | $3,165 |
| Inglewood 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,385 | $929 | $4,301 |
| Inglewood 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,012 | $929 | $4,893 |
Inglewood 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,611 | $1,655 | $8,950 |
| Inglewood 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,010 | $1,851 | $8,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Inglewood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Inglewood with 3 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Inglewood is at Mirage Town Homes II listed at $1,655.
How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Inglewood Apartment?
The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Inglewood is $3,611.
What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Inglewood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Inglewood is a 1,699 square feet unit starting from $5,451 at Hollywood Park Residences.
What is the average size for Inglewood 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Inglewood is currently 1,575 sq ft.
